🛠️ Refactor suggestion

Add transaction success and error handling.

The component tracks loading states but doesn't handle transaction success or errors. Users need feedback when their transactions complete or fail.

Consider using the transaction receipt hooks to provide user feedback:

const { isLoading: isMinting, isSuccess: isMintSuccess, isError: isMintError } = useWaitForTransactionReceipt({
  hash: mintData,
});

// Add useEffect to handle success/error states
useEffect(() => {
  if (isMintSuccess) {
    alert("Tokens minted successfully!");
    setMintAmount("");
    getTokenDetails(); // Refresh token details
  }
  if (isMintError) {
    alert("Minting failed. Please try again.");
  }
}, [isMintSuccess, isMintError]);

🛠️ Refactor suggestion

⚠️ Potential issue

Clarify UI labels and add validation for reduction operations.

The contract function reduceMaxSupply implies a one-way reduction, but the UI label "Update Max Supply" could mislead users into thinking they can increase it. Additionally, there's no validation to ensure the new value is actually lower than the current value.

+                 <Label htmlFor="newMaxSupply" className="text-lg">Reduce Max Supply (Current: {tokenDetails.maxSupply})</Label>
                  <Input
                    id="newMaxSupply"
                    type="number"
-                   placeholder="Enter new max supply"
+                   placeholder="Enter new max supply (must be lower)"
                    value={newMaxSupply}
                    onChange={(e) => setNewMaxSupply(e.target.value)}
                    className="h-12 text-lg"
                  />
                  <Button
-                   onClick={() => reduceMaxSupply({
+                   onClick={() => {
+                     const newValue = parseFloat(newMaxSupply);
+                     if (isNaN(newValue) || newValue <= 0) {
+                       alert("Please enter a valid positive amount");
+                       return;
+                     }
+                     if (newValue >= tokenDetails.maxSupply) {
+                       alert("New max supply must be lower than current value");
+                       return;
+                     }
+                     reduceMaxSupply({
                       abi: CONTRIBUTION_ACCOUNTING_TOKEN_ABI,
                       address: tokenAddress,
                       functionName: "reduceMaxSupply",
                       args: [parseEther(newMaxSupply)]
-                   })}
+                     })
+                   }}
                    disabled={!newMaxSupply || isReducingMaxSupply}
                    className="w-full h-12 text-lg"
                  >
-                   {isReducingMaxSupply ? "Updating..." : "Update Max Supply"}
+                   {isReducingMaxSupply ? "Reducing..." : "Reduce Max Supply"}
                  </Button>

⚠️ Potential issue

Add input validation and error handling for minting.

The mint function should validate inputs before execution:

  1. Check if the user is connected (address is defined)
  2. Validate that mintAmount is a positive number
  3. Handle potential parsing errors
 <Button
   onClick={() => {
+    if (!address) {
+      alert("Please connect your wallet");
+      return;
+    }
+    const amount = parseFloat(mintAmount);
+    if (isNaN(amount) || amount <= 0) {
+      alert("Please enter a valid positive amount");
+      return;
+    }
     mint({
       abi: CONTRIBUTION_ACCOUNTING_TOKEN_ABI,
       address: tokenAddress,
       functionName: "mint",
       args: [address, parseEther(mintAmount)]
     })
   }}
   disabled={!mintAmount || isMinting}
   className="w-full h-12 text-lg"
 >
   {isMinting ? "Minting..." : "Mint Tokens"}
 </Button>
